I have a bunch of questions, but will post 1 at a time for better search results

How do you remove/disable the google voice(?) bar at the top of the screen?
Possibly called something else. It is the white bar with Google and a mic icon.
I do not want to root the phone as it is new.

TIA
 
You can install any number of different launchers and just not put the search bar/icon on. I use Nova (prime) but there are a bunch of other nice ones too. No root needed :)
 
Alternate launcher is the only way. I use Nova Launcher Prime and it is one of the reasons I do so. Some of the other reasons ... toggle the bar at the top of the screen off and on ... hide the pre-installed software so I don't have to see it ... save/restore the launcher setup so a Factory Data Reset is a much smaller impact.

There is no downside to running an alternate launcher that I am aware of. Also, some launchers are capable of importing the settings from your previous launcher, so setup time is literally just minutes. Nova can do Import; I don't remember if Apex can, though it does give you many options to the Google Search bar beyond just removing it.
 
Only downside ... on the Droid Maxx the Droid Command Center widget(AKA Circles widget) will only run under the stock launcher. This may be true for some other models also. It is not a problem on the Droid Turbo. (Assuming you care about that widget.)
